Idaho Road Landform Graphics (ADOT)
Project Description: The work consists of constructing landform rock graphics in the form of coyotes on the roadway slopes at each of the four corners of the traffic interchanges (TI) of the US60/Idaho Road. The design and construction is using similar concepts used at the other US60 TIs within the city.

Southern Avenue and Meridian Road (MCDOT)
Intersection and Drainage Improvement Project
Project Description: The improvements will include installation of a traffic signal, sidewalk ramps, curb & gutter, street lighting and left turn lanes in all four directions. Drainage improvements include a three-barrel concrete box culvert drainage structure through the existing low water crossing to provide an all-weather crossing and concrete channel lining in the vicinity of the new culvert crossing.
